Sweeteners in the Philippines: Sugar vs. HFCS
Now, let's zoom in on one of the most significant differences you might find in Coca-Cola ingredients across various regions, particularly concerning sweeteners, and how this plays out right here in the Philippines. While many countries, especially the United States, predominantly use High-Fructose Corn Syrup (HFCS) as their main sweetener in Coca-Cola, the Philippines largely utilizes cane sugar. This is a pretty big deal, guys, and it’s a point of pride for many Filipinos who prefer the taste of sugar-sweetened beverages. The choice to use cane sugar in the Philippines is deeply rooted in several factors, including the country's robust sugar industry. The Philippines is a significant producer of cane sugar, making it a readily available and often economically viable option for local production. This local sourcing supports Philippine agriculture and the livelihoods of countless sugar farmers, creating a strong link between your favorite beverage and the national economy. From a taste perspective, many consumers, both locally and internationally, claim that Coke made with cane sugar has a crisper, cleaner, and more natural sweetness compared to HFCS. While the average person might not always detect the difference, for some, it’s a noticeable and preferred distinction. The debate between cane sugar and HFCS is ongoing, with discussions often centered around health implications, processing methods, and perceived naturalness. Cane sugar is a disaccharide (sucrose) made from glucose and fructose, while HFCS is a processed sweetener where corn starch is broken down into glucose, and then some of that glucose is converted into fructose. Both, when consumed in excess, contribute to calorie intake and can have similar metabolic effects, but the perception and preference for cane sugar remain strong here. Caramel Color: The Iconic Hue
Next, let’s talk about caramel color, which is more than just a visual element; it's an iconic part of the Coca-Cola identity. This ingredient is responsible for giving Coke its distinctive, deep brown hue, a color so recognizable that it’s almost synonymous with the brand itself. Imagine a clear Coke – it would look completely different and, let's be honest, probably not as appealing! The caramel color used in Coca-Cola is typically a Class IV caramel color, which is produced by heating carbohydrates (like corn syrup or sugar) with ammonium compounds. While there have been some discussions and concerns in the past regarding a compound called 4-methylimidazole (4-MEI) that can be a byproduct of this process, regulatory bodies like the FDA and EFSA have widely concluded that the levels found in beverages like Coca-Cola are not a health risk for consumers. Coca-Cola, for its part, has worked to reduce 4-MEI levels in its products in many markets. Phosphoric Acid: The Tangy Kick and Preservative
Now, let's get into phosphoric acid, an ingredient that plays a couple of really important roles in your Coca-Cola. Firstly, it contributes significantly to the drink's signature tangy, slightly tart flavor profile, balancing out the sweetness from the sugar. Without phosphoric acid, Coke would taste overwhelmingly sweet and lack that characteristic bite that makes it so refreshing. It's part of the secret blend that gives Coke its complexity. Secondly, and equally importantly, phosphoric acid acts as a preservative. Its acidic nature helps to inhibit the growth of bacteria and molds, thereby extending the shelf life of the beverage and ensuring that it remains safe and fresh for consumption over time. This preservative quality is vital for a product distributed globally, ensuring consistent quality from the factory to your hand. While some may have concerns about phosphoric acid's effect on bone health, particularly in very high consumption levels, numerous scientific studies and health organizations generally indicate that, in the amounts present in soft drinks, it poses no significant risk to the average person with a balanced diet.
